Type 1 diabetes is a chronic condition that requires constant monitoring and management of blood sugar levels. For young people with type 1 diabetes, this can be particularly challenging as they navigate the demands of school, social activities, and growing up. However, recent advancements in diabetes technology, specifically hybrid closed-loop systems, are revolutionizing the way young people with type 1 diabetes manage their condition.
Hybrid closed-loop systems, also known as artificial pancreas systems, combine continuous glucose monitoring (CGM) with insulin pump therapy to automatically adjust insulin delivery based on real-time glucose levels. This technology aims to mimic the function of a healthy pancreas by providing more precise and timely insulin dosing, ultimately leading to better glycemic control.
One of the key benefits of hybrid closed-loop systems for young people with type 1 diabetes is the reduction of hypoglycemia (low blood sugar) and hyperglycemia (high blood sugar) episodes. By continuously monitoring glucose levels and adjusting insulin delivery accordingly, these systems help prevent dangerous fluctuations in blood sugar levels that can lead to serious health complications.
In a recent article published in The Diabetes Times, researchers highlighted the positive impact of hybrid closed-loop systems on glycemic management in young people with type 1 diabetes. The study found that participants using the system experienced significant improvements in time spent within target glucose range, as well as reductions in both hypoglycemia and hyperglycemia events.
Furthermore, the study also noted improvements in quality of life for young people using hybrid closed-loop systems. Participants reported feeling more confident in managing their diabetes and experienced fewer disruptions to their daily activities due to fluctuations in blood sugar levels.
